Abstract
The paper presents a method to derive an optimal parametric sensitivity controller for optimal estimation of a set of parameters in an experiment. The method is demonstrated for a fed batch bio-reactor case study for optimal estimation of the saturation constant Ks and, albeit intuitively, the parameter combination μmaxX/Y where μmax is the maximum growth rate [g/min], Y is the yield coefficient [g/g], and X is the (constant) biomass [g].
